Albanian government has approved the salary increase for some sectors, specifically in health, education and in the field of security.

The Minister of Economy, Delina Ibrahimaj, said that the government made the decision to increase the salaries of support employees of the public administration. “We approved an important draft law, specifically for the determination of salaries. Today we started and approved several draft decisions for salary increases for the health, education and security sectors, specifically for prison police, guards and firefighters. Pursuant to the decision taken earlier, from April 1, the salaries of public administration support workers will also increase,” said Ibrahimaj.

ABC News journalist, Esiona Konomi, asked the minister where this money will be taken to support the reform for salary increases, for this the minister said: “The annual cost, in 2025, of this reform is at the level of 38 billion ALL. These funds are provided either from the increase in income or from internal reallocations. They are costs that are borne within the macro fiscal system.

We will continue to reduce the debt and the deficit. For 2023, we had foreseen salary increase policy and it was worth 2.4 billion ALL that affected education, health and the field of IT. The salary increase also comes as a result of the inflationary crisis, so there are several items provided in the budget that accommodate the salary increase and the additional cost expected for this year”, said Ibrahimaj.
